It seems like running batch files (.bat, .cmd) inside a directory with an at sign and a space (such as '@ x' or 'x @') fails.
/w/temp/@ x$ ./hello.bat
'W:\temp\@' is not recognized as an internal or external command,
operable program or batch file.
